Mon, July 13, 2009 - 9:59 PMIf that spool valve has rings, you may just need to replace them; if not, you'll likely need to line bore the valve body & turn a new spool to match.
The easiest way to do that is to make a plug gage that just fits the cleaned up valve bore, and then make the spool match it.

Sat, July 18, 2009 - 12:16 PMThe spool only has water rings, I considered putting rings of some sort in the grooves, but the way the ports are set up, they would jam. There are no "bridges" between the ports, so the rings would pop out and get caught. I will just have to turn a spool at some point.
